Global Privacy Benchmarks Report

The Global Privacy Benchmarks Report is a pivotal analysis of the evolving privacy landscape amid rapid technological advancements, particularly in artificial intelligence (AI), and intensifying regulatory scrutiny. Commissioned by TrustArc and conducted independently by Golfdale Consulting, the report draws from a comprehensive survey of 1,775 privacy professionals across diverse roles including executives, managers, full-time employees, […]

Utah AI Policy Act

Utah AI Act

In the high desert of Utah, where innovation often meets pragmatism, a new law has quietly taken root, marking a significant step in America’s patchwork approach to regulating artificial intelligence. Signed into law on March 13, 2024, by Governor Spencer Cox, the Utah AI Policy Act (SB 149) positions the state as a pioneer in […]

Oregon’s AI Frontier: Attorney General Issues Guidance for Businesses

In the waning days of her tenure, Oregon Attorney General Ellen Rosenblum dropped a parting gift—or warning, depending on your perspective—for the state’s businesses: a set of guidelines on how artificial intelligence fits into Oregon’s legal landscape. Issued on December 24, 2024, just before she handed the reins to Dan Rayfield, the document titled “What […]
